Maintenance Lead

This role contributes to our mission by ensuring production equipment operates efficiently and safely.
Responsibilities
- Adhere to all health and safety policies/procedures, Good Manufacturing Practices (GMPs), and wear required personal protective equipment (PPE) in warehouse or production areas (e.g., hairnets, beard nets, safety glasses, hearing protection, steel toe boots, seatbelts while operating forklifts).
- Adhere to food quality and food safety standards, including Safe Quality Food requirements.
- Perform complex corrective and preventative maintenance, applying thorough knowledge of mechanical theories and principles.
- Ensure equipment upgrades comply with the Occupational Health & Safety Act.
- Minimize downtime by managing replacement/spare parts through preventative maintenance, following manufacturer’s guidelines.
- Assist in scheduling maintenance personnel to cover production line needs.
- Contribute to measurable improvements in scheduled, unscheduled, and breakdown maintenance downtime and associated costs to meet CPC (cost per case) goals; share best practices across the enterprise.
- Review daily preventative maintenance (PM) sheets and ensure work completion.
- Update work orders to reflect changes in production lines.
- Coordinate and address equipment failures promptly to minimize downtime.
- Support Electricians and Mechanics with machine issues on the production floor.
- Assist in training Electricians/Mechanics on production equipment and maintain the Lockout/Tagout Program.
- Coordinate parts requirements with the Parts Coordinator.
- Participate in Continuous Improvement Projects and support initiatives with technical expertise.
- Escalate unresolved downtime issues exceeding plant targets.
